Nyom is located in Berlin, Germany on Gabriel-Max-Straße 17. Nyom is rated 4.3 out of 5 in the category vietnamese restaurant in Germany.

Lovely Vietnamese food with a good atmosphere. ‘The Hanoi Soup’ was really really delicious and so was the ‘Beef Bowl’. The food was so fresh and tasteful and came 10 min after we ordered it. But there were some issues too. The beer was warm and not cold. The toilet was kinda dirty (ew ew not good). And the waiter asked us for tips in a really awkward way, which made the end of the experience weird and not so pleasant.

Food as mediocre. After we asked for the check, the waiter came with an attidude. He wanted to handle everyting really fast. My friend paid his part, the waiter didn’t give back the change and kept it without asking. We were going to tip anyways but after seeing that I decided not to tip. My part was 49.4 Euros, gave him 50. He said tip is not included. I said it’s ok. He shouted again “tip is not included”. I said, good to know. And he started shouted in his native language (most probably cursing) and said “is 60 cents all you give to me?” in German. Well, tipping is not an obligation, especially if the waiter is not a nice one. Pity I didn’t ask that 60 cents as well. All in all, their waiters need some training I guess.
